Suggested edit: William Boyd's death occurred in rural Hibbing, St. Louis County, Minnesota, while he was visiting his son Frank Edgar Monroe. His son filed a missing persons report. Months later Boyd's decomposed body was found by berry pickers. No autopsy could be performed due to condition of the body, the cause of death remains unknown. A possible fall, a stroke or some natural cause is to blame. My grandfather Frank Edgar Monroe never talked about it.
